什么编程能做裁剪机子视频
-
要做裁剪机子视频编程,可以选择使用机器视觉技术和图像处理算法。下面是一种可能的解决方案:
-
采集视频数据: 要使用裁剪机子进行视频裁剪,首先需要将视频数据采集到计算机中。可以使用摄像头或者外部设备连接来获取视频流。
-
图像预处理: 在对视频进行裁剪之前,通常需要对图像进行一些预处理,以便提高后续处理的效果。预处理包括图像去噪、图像增强、图像平滑等操作。
-
目标检测: 裁剪机子需要能够自动识别视频中的目标物体,以便能够准确地进行裁剪。目标检测可以使用深度学习的方法,例如使用卷积神经网络(CNN)进行目标检测。
-
目标跟踪: 一旦检测到目标物体,裁剪机子需要能够跟踪目标物体的运动,以便实时调整裁剪机子的位置和角度。跟踪可以使用基于特征匹配的方法,例如使用光流算法进行目标追踪。
-
裁剪控制: 根据目标的位置和运动轨迹,裁剪机子需要能够实时调整裁剪刀具的位置和角度,以便精确地进行裁剪操作。裁剪控制可以使用伺服电机或者步进电机进行精确控制。
-
系统集成: 最后,需要将图像处理和控制功能集成到裁剪机子的硬件和软件系统中。可以使用嵌入式系统、计算机视觉库和控制算法进行系统集成。
总结:要实现裁剪机子视频编程,需要采集视频数据、进行图像预处理、目标检测和跟踪、裁剪控制以及系统集成。整个过程需要使用机器视觉技术和图像处理算法,并将其与裁剪机子的硬件和软件系统进行集成。这样就可以实现自动化的视频裁剪操作。
1年前 -
-
编程可以用于控制裁剪机的视频裁剪过程。下面是五个关键点:
-
控制接口:为了编程控制裁剪机的视频裁剪过程,需要了解裁剪机的控制接口。通常,裁剪机会配备有一个控制面板或者通过计算机连接的软件界面,可以通过这些接口来控制裁剪机的各种功能。
-
视频编辑软件:要实现视频裁剪,编程可以利用视频编辑软件的API或SDK来控制裁剪机。通过调用软件提供的接口,编程可以自动打开视频文件,选择需要裁剪的部分,设置裁剪参数,并进行裁剪操作。
-
时间轴编辑:视频编辑软件通常采用时间轴编辑的方式来控制视频的裁剪操作。编程可以通过设置时间轴上的起始时间和结束时间来选取需要裁剪的视频片段。此外,还可以设置其他参数,如裁剪速度、过渡效果等。
-
视频格式转换:裁剪机通常支持多种视频格式,但是不同的裁剪机对视频格式的支持有所差异。编程可以通过调用编解码库或使用专用的视频格式转换工具,将视频文件转换为裁剪机支持的格式,以便进行裁剪。
-
批处理:如果需要对大量视频进行裁剪,编程可以实现批处理功能。通过编写脚本或程序,可以自动遍历指定文件夹下的所有视频文件,并逐个进行裁剪操作。这样可以大大提高效率,节省时间和人力成本。
总结起来,通过编程可以实现对裁剪机的视频裁剪过程进行自动化控制。编程者需要熟悉裁剪机的控制接口和视频编辑软件的API,以及视频格式转换和批处理等相关技术,才能有效地完成这项任务。
1年前 -
-
为了能够对裁剪机的视频进行编程,你可以使用一种流行的编程语言或者开发平台来编写代码来实现这个目标。以下是一种常见的方法和操作流程,以帮助你理解如何编程来处理裁剪机的视频。
-
确定编程语言和开发平台
首先,你需要确定使用哪种编程语言和开发平台来进行视频处理。一些常用的编程语言包括Python、Java、C++和C#,而一些常用的开发平台包括OpenCV、FFmpeg和GStreamer。根据你的项目需求和个人技能,选择一个适合的编程语言和开发平台进行视频处理。 -
安装相关的库和工具
接下来,你需要安装相关的库和工具,这些库和工具可以帮助你在所选的编程语言和开发平台上进行视频处理。例如,如果你使用的是Python,你可以安装OpenCV和MoviePy库来处理视频。如果你使用的是Java,你可以使用JavaFX和Xuggler库。根据你使用的编程语言和开发平台,查找并安装适当的库和工具。 -
加载和剪切视频
在处理视频之前,你需要加载视频并从中选择要裁剪的部分。根据所选的库和工具,编写代码来加载视频文件,并确定你想要裁剪的时间段。你可以使用库中提供的函数或方法来指定开始和结束的时间戳,并剪切出你感兴趣的部分。 -
裁剪视频
一旦你确定了要裁剪的时间段,你可以使用视频处理库中的函数或方法来裁剪视频。根据你选择的编程语言和开发平台,调用适当的函数或方法来实现裁剪。根据视频处理库的文档,了解如何指定裁剪的时间段,并将代码添加到你的项目中来实现视频剪切。 -
导出并保存裁剪后的视频
完成视频的裁剪后,你可以使用视频处理库中的函数或方法导出和保存裁剪后的视频。根据你选择的编程语言和开发平台,调用适当的函数或方法将裁剪后的视频保存到指定的目录。根据视频处理库的文档,了解如何导出和保存视频,并将代码添加到你的项目中来实现这一操作。 -
测试和调试
完成代码编写后,你可以进行测试和调试,以确保视频裁剪功能正常工作。加载一段视频并使用你编写的代码进行裁剪,检查裁剪后的视频是否正确。如果有错误或问题,查看错误信息并尝试解决它们。使用适当的调试工具和技术,对代码进行修改和优化,以提高视频处理的性能和质量。
总结
以上是一种常见的方法和操作流程,用于编程处理裁剪机的视频。根据你选择的编程语言和开发平台,可能会有一些差异,但基本的步骤是相似的。通过选择适当的编程语言和开发平台,并使用相关的库和工具,你可以编写代码来加载、剪切和保存裁剪后的视频,从而实现对裁剪机的视频进行编程处理。1年前 -